Output 40edb21fdd9697fa9e2a43e6a9b58e59735f2a6205ac86b212dee6f3789bf2d4:0

value
5806318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73443c42ddbf64f6506dfae73f27eea146bbb823 OP_EQUAL
address
3CCVNgYdk8Dh1pcbqsrq6RCFdk5BPbx3N9
transaction
40edb21fdd9697fa9e2a43e6a9b58e59735f2a6205ac86b212dee6f3789bf2d4
spent
true